Thiruvananthapuram: Kerala’s Leader of Opposition and Senior Congress leader, VD Satheesan, criticized Pinarayi Vijayan for today’s protest in New Delhi against the Central government. He said that the protest is a covert creation by Pinarayi Vijayan to conceal his government’s corruption and extravagance. Satheesan made these remarks while speaking to the media in Thiruvananthapuram.
VD Satheesan stated that the UDF cannot agree with the narrative that the Center’s neglect is the cause of all the financial crises Kerala is facing. He added that Kerala’s financial crisis is entirely due to the mismanagement, corruption, and extravagance of the Pinarayi government.
Satheesan further claimed that it is a falsehood that Rs 57,800 crore has to be paid by the Central government, suggesting that the Pinarayi government is fabricating stories of central neglect in fund allocation to hide its own mismanagement and corruption. He pointed out that the Kerala government’s allegations against the Central government are inconsistent, with data submitted in various forums not aligning. Satheesan argued that the Kerala government’s claims of receiving Rs 57,800 crore from the central government are inflated.
Satheesan emphasized that the mismanagement in tax administration, corruption, and extravagance of the Kerala government are the primary causes of the financial crisis, an issue previously raised by Congress leaders in the Assembly.
He criticized the Pinarayi government for comparing allocations from the 15th Finance Commission with those from the 10th Finance Commission, suggesting that such a comparison is inappropriate given the time gap between the two commissions. He added that if comparing the 15th Finance Commission with the 14th is acceptable, whereas the 10th Finance Commission came into operation in 1995.
Satheesan further highlighted that the Kerala government has failed to disburse social welfare pensions, salaries, and pensions for retired employees, while infrastructural developments in the state remain lacking due to the government’s administrative failures. Despite this, the Pinarayi government continues to borrow for its extravagant spending, with the Supreme Court also capping Kerala’s borrowing.
Satheesan questioned the purpose of protesting in Delhi against the Central government in this situation. He mocked the Pinarayi government, asking whether it was unaware of the situation regarding fund allocation. Satheesan criticized the decision to stage a protest at Delhi in this situation, describing it as a tactical approach to divert attention from the state government’s mismanagement, corruption, and extravagance.
